About this card

HP: 50Type: ColorlessSubtype: BasicEvolves to: Lopunny

"When it senses danger, it perks up its ears. On cold nights, it sleeps with its head tucked into its fur."

Drawup Power

Search your deck for an Energy card, show it to your opponent, and put it into your hand. Shuffle your deck afterward.

[Colorless]Extend Ears — 10

Remove 1 damage counter from each of your Benched Pokémon.

Weakness: Fighting +10

Retreat cost: Colorless

Frequently asked

How can I tell if my Buneary is real?

Buneary is not on our list of commonly-counterfeited cards, but counterfeits exist across every set. Check the back-light test (real cards have a black inner layer that blocks light; counterfeits glow through), the rosette dot pattern on the back under magnification, font weight and kerning on the card name, and the holofoil pattern if applicable. For high-value copies we recommend submitting to a professional grader (PSA, BGS, CGC) for tamper-evident authentication.
